Built In Cabinetry Staining in Kokomo, IN
Built-in cabinetry staining services focus on enhancing the appearance and durability of existing built-in furniture such as bookshelves, entertainment centers, and kitchen cabinets. This process involves applying a stain to change or deepen the color of the wood, highlighting its natural grain while providing a uniform finish. Property owners often request this service to refresh the look of their cabinetry, match new decor, or restore older woodwork to a more vibrant and appealing state. Projects can range from small updates in a single room to comprehensive renovations of multiple built-in units throughout a home.
Before requesting built-in cabinetry staining, property owners typically want to understand the scope of the work, including the type of wood and current finish, as well as the desired color outcome. It is also important to consider the condition of the existing surfaces, as repairs or sanding may be necessary to ensure an even and long-lasting stain. Clarifying expectations around the color intensity, sheen, and maintenance requirements can help achieve a result that complements the overall style of the property.

Built In Cabinetry Staining Questions
What types of cabinetry can be stained? Built-in cabinetry made of wood or wood-like materials can be stained to enhance their appearance and match existing decor.
Is staining suitable for all cabinet finishes? Staining works best on raw or lightly finished wood surfaces; it may not be effective on heavily painted or laminated cabinets.
How does staining impact the durability of cabinetry? Proper staining can protect wood surfaces and improve their resistance to moisture and wear.
Can staining change the color of existing built-in cabinets? Yes, staining can alter the color and highlight the natural grain of the wood, giving cabinets a refreshed look.
